Welcome to TELUS Digital — where innovation drives impact at a global scale. As an award-winning digital product consultancy and the digital division of TELUS, one of Canada’s largest telecommunications providers, we design and deliver transformative customer experiences through cutting-edge technology, agile thinking, and a people-first culture.
With a global team across North America, South America, Central America, Europe, Africa, and APAC, we offer end-to-end expertise across eight core service areas: Digital Product Consulting, Digital Marketing Services, Data & AI, Strategy Consulting, Business Operations Modernization, Enterprise Applications, Cloud Engineering, and QA & Test Engineering.
From mobile apps and websites to voice UI, chatbots, AI, customer service, and in-store solutions, TELUS Digital enables seamless, trusted, and digitally powered experiences that meet customers wherever they are — all backed by the secure infrastructure and scale of our multi-billion-dollar parent company.

As a Senior Digital Marketing Engineer your recommendations and strategies will play an integral part in the end-to-end creation, evolution, and user experience of the world’s best digital products.
Conduct discovery engagements to determine a client’s optimal marketing tech stack
Implement and operate tools across the MarTech stack, including Customer Engagement Platforms, CDP, CRM, Product Analytics, MMPs, and Loyalty platforms.
Lead complex business/technical integrations across a variety of client apps and tools such as Braze, Salesforce Marketing Cloud, mParticle, Segment, Punchh, Talon.One, Amplitude, Mixpanel, Branch, Appsflyer, Adobe (AEP, RT-CDP, ACS, AJO)
Calibrate technology platforms to align with business metrics, including audience segmentation, analytics dashboards, email automation, and more
Train clients on how to use their growth stack and advise on best practices
Create technical documentation for engineers that outlines and communicates specific project needs by sprint, following agile frameworks
Drive ongoing client success and satisfaction by determining the scope of various engagements, communicating regularly with various stakeholders, and learning business goals and technology infrastructure
Resolve a wide range of customer needs from basic education to technical operations
Develop relationships with technology vendors to collaboratively develop customized solutions for clients
Master's Degree with 2 years of experience or a Bachelor's Degree in business, marketing, communications.
3+ years of experience in a client-facing marketing strategy role or account management role.
Knowledge of various MarTech tools - CEP, CDP, Analytics, MMP, Loyalty - preferably in one or more of Braze, Salesforce Marketing Cloud, mParticle, Segment, Punchh, Talon.One, Amplitude, Mixpanel, Branch, Appsflyer, and Adobe (AEP, RT-CDP, ACS, AJO), including integration best practices and strategies
Experience successfully developing and leading multi-phase projects with various stakeholders
Advanced knowledge of data-driven marketing practices: audience segmentation, personalization, retargeting, automation, etc.
Proven success in planning and deploying integrated digital marketing campaigns to drive acquisition, increase retention, or improve customer long-term value
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al
Experience with effective reporting: analytics, attribution, ad serving, CDPs and CRMs, push, email marketing, social media
Experience integrating with data warehouses (e.g., Redshift, Snowflake) and BI tools (e.g., Looker, Tableau)
